Warning Signs You Need Sprinkler System Water Removal

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. That’s why it’s essential to catch these signs early and take action quickly. Our team has identified the following warning signs that show you need Sprinkler System Water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ant Smells – If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your home or business, it could be a sign of water damage. Hidden Damage – Water damage can be hidden behind walls, under flooring, or in other hard-to-reach areas, making it essential to investigate further.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Visible Damage – If your flooring appears warped, buckled, or discolored, it may be a sign of water damage. Structural Integrity – Water damage can compromise the structural integrity of your property, making it essential to address the issue quickly.

Discolored or Stained Walls

Visible Signs – If your walls appear discolored or stained, it could be a sign of water damage. Hidden Leaks – Water damage can be caused by hidden leaks, making it essential to investigate further.

Increased Humidity or Mold Growth

Unpleasant Odors – If you notice an increase in humidity or mold growth in your home or business, it could be a sign of water damage. Health Risks – Mold growth can pose serious health risks, making it essential to address the issue quickly.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Unsettling Sounds – If you notice unusual noises or sounds in your home or business, it could be a sign of water damage. Hidden Leaks – Water damage can be caused by hidden leaks, making it essential to investigate further.

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ost In Tupelo, MS

The cost of Sprinkler System Water Removal in Tupelo, MS,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ates to ensure you understand the costs involved and can make informed decisions about your property’s restoration.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 Amount of water extracted, equipment used, and labor costs
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and labor costs
Sanitizing and Cleaning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used, and labor costs
Final Inspection and Certification $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of the job, and labor costs
